MLB Launches Out-of-Market Game Live Video Webcast Service

Authored by Mark Hefflinger on March 11, 2003 - 6:09am.
New York -- Major League Baseball Advanced Media on Tuesday announced the launch of a live video streaming service for out-of-market baseball games, offering fans access to broadcasts of games played outside of teams' local TV blackout areas. The service will offer a total of about 1,000 games -- about 3 games per each team each week -- charging $14.95 per month, $79.95 for the entire season or $2.95 per game. Games on MLB.tv will be streamed at 330k using RealNetworks' technology. MLB.com is offering a sample of the service with nine free Spring Training game webcasts, beginning with the March 13th game between the Boston Red Sox and New York Yankees. http://biz.yahoo.com/prnews/030311/nytu054_1.html
